| Fixes & Changes going from UVR v5.4 to v5.5: |
|
|
| ~ The progress bar is now fully synced up with every process in the application. |
| ~ Fixed low-resolution icon. |
| ~ Added the ability to download models manually if the application can't connect |
| to the internet. |
| ~ Drag-n-drop is functional across all os platforms. |
| ~ Resolved mp3 tag issue in MacOS version. |
|
|
| Performance: |
|
|
| ~ Model load times are faster. |
| ~ Importing/exporting audio files is faster. |
|
|
| MacOS M1 Notes: |
|
|
| ~ The GPU Conversion checkbox will enable MPS for GPU acceleration. However, |
| only the VR Architecture models are currently compatible with it. |

| New Options: |
|
|
| ~ Select Saved Settings option - Allows the user to save the current settings |
| of the whole application. You can also load a saved setting or reset them to |
| the default. |
| ~ Right-click menu - Allows for quick access to important options. |
| ~ Help Hints option - When enabled, users can hover over options to see a pop-up |
| text that describes that option. The right-clicking option also allows copying |
| the "Help Hint" text. |
| ~ Secondary Model Mode - This option is an expanded version of the "Demucs Model" |
| option that was only available to MDX-Net. Except now, this option is available |
| in all three AI Networks and for any stem. Any model can now be Secondary, and |
| the user can choose the amount of influence it has on the final result. |
| ~ Robust caching for ensemble mode, allowing for much faster processing times. |
| ~ Clicking the "Input" field will pop up a window allowing the user to review the selected audio inputs. Within this menu, users can: |
| ~ Remove inputs. |
| ~ Verify inputs. |
| ~ Create samples of chosen inputs. |
| ~ "Sample Mode" option - Allows the user to process only part of a track to sample |
| settings or a model without running a full conversion. |
| ~ The number in the parentheses is the current number of seconds the generated |
| sample will be. |
| ~ You can choose the number of seconds to extract from the track in the "Additional |
| Settings" menu. |
|
|
| VR Architecture: |
|
|
| ~ Ability to toggle "High-End Processing." |
| ~ Ability to change the post-processing threshold. |
| ~ Support for the latest VR architecture |
| ~ Crop Size and Batch Size are specifically for models using the latest |
| architecture only. |
|
|
| MDX-NET: |
|
|
| ~ Denoise Output option results in cleaner results, |
| but the processing time will be longer. This option has replaced Noise Reduction. |
| ~ Spectral Inversion option uses spectral inversion techniques for a |
| cleaner secondary stem result. This option may slow down the audio export process. |
| ~ Secondary stem now has the same frequency cut-off as the main stem. |
|
|
| Demucs: |
|
|
| ~ Demucs v4 models are now supported, including the 6-stem model. |
| ~ Ability to combine remaining stems instead of inverting selected stem with the |
| mixture only when a user does not select "All Stems". |
| ~ A Pre-process model that allows the user to run an inference through a robust |
| vocal or instrumental model and separate the remaining stems from its generated |
| instrumental mix. This option can significantly reduce vocal bleed in other |
| Demucs-generated non-vocal stems. |
| ~ The Pre-process model is intended for Demucs separations for all stems except |
| vocals and instrumentals. |
|
|
| Ensemble Mode: |
|
|
| ~ Ensemble Mode has been extended to include the following: |
| ~ Averaging is a new algorithm that averages the final results. |
| ~ Unlimited models in the ensemble. |
| ~ Ability to save different ensembles. |
| ~ Ability to ensemble outputs for all individual stem types. |
| ~ Ability to choose unique ensemble algorithms. |
| ~ Ability to ensemble all 4 Demucs stems at once. |
